Saint Francis Genetics
Saint Francis Genetics
Office
6161 South Yale Avenue
Tulsa, OK 74136
Primary Specialty
Hospital
Practice
Saint Francis Genetics
About
Saint Francis Genetics
Saint Francis Genetics is a Hospital facility at 6161 South Yale Avenue in Tulsa, OK.
Services
Saint Francis Genetics is a Hospital, clinic, emergency, medicine, doctor, ER, ICU, hospital room, hospital ward, nurse, doctor, physician, treatment facility
Please call Saint Francis Genetics at to schedule an appointment in Tulsa, OK or get more information.